Beware of a new scam targeting laptop users. A bogus power bank is making the rounds, advertising to charge your device with ease. But this deceptive product simply won't deliver on its vows .
Sadly , when you attach your laptop, the power bank does nothing . This is because it lacks the necessary circuitry to supply power to your device.
Users are left powerless to use their laptops, frustrated by this heartless scam.
Here's what you can do :
* Consider reputable stores .
* Research online before making a purchase.
* Inspect the product for any signs of imitation.
By taking precautions, you can stay safe from falling victim to these deceptive schemes .
